Key Responsibilities:
1. Root Cause Identification & Problem Resolution: Analyze issues within the supply chain or Amazon’s internal systems, lead initiatives to resolve them, conduct follow-up actions, communicate opportunities for improvement, and create action plans.
2. Supplier Trend Analysis: Identify and analyze key supplier trends to govern mediation requirements, ensuring effective resolution of disputes.
3. Vendor Relationship Management: Serve as the primary point of contact for Amazon’s top suppliers, fostering strong business relationships, building mutual trust, and resolving conflicts to prevent shipment holds or disruptions in operations.
4. Vendor Health Scorecard & Account Management: Prepare and manage vendor health scorecards, conduct regular reviews, and proactively address accounts at risk of delivery holds or disruptions by working on account balances.
5. Vendor Support: Address vendor inquiries and concerns, ensuring they are well-equipped with knowledge of Amazon’s tools and processes.
6. Operational Performance Analysis: Analyze key operational metrics and present data to both vendors and internal teams, ensuring alignment on performance goals and continuous improvement.
7. Attention to Detail & Problem Resolution: Work independently with a keen eye for detail, quickly identifying and resolving discrepancies, variances, and failures with high accuracy.
8. Collaboration with Cross-functional Teams: Partner with Retail and Finance teams to align priorities, business decisions, objectives, and communication strategies for vendor accounts.
